一个人类精子发生相关新基因TSARG7的克隆和初步功能研究

精子发生是一个多基因参与的复杂的生理过程,虽然人们克隆了一些与精子发生相关的基因,但迄今为止,人们对精子发生的分子机制了解有限,因而克隆相关的新基因,并研究其在理论上和实践上的功能仍然十分重要.该文从人类睾丸cDNA文库出发,以小鼠精子发生相关基因mTSARG7基因为电子探针,得到1个与人类的精子发生相关的新基因TSARG7(GenBank登录号为AY513610).该基因的cDNA全长为2 463 bp,含有12个外显子和11个内含子,定位在人类8号染色体8p11.21上.TSARG7编码的蛋白质含有456个氨基酸,分子量为56.295 kDa,等电点为9.13,为胞浆中非分泌性蛋白,具有磷酸酰基转移酶(PISC)的结构域,属于酰基转移酶家族的新成员,该家族成员具有脂质合成的功能.TSARG7和mTSARG7,TSARG7和Au041707分别具有97%的同源性.该基因在睾丸中特异表达,亚细胞定位在胞浆中表达.TSARG7 mRNA在13岁的睾丸中开始表达,并且随着精子的发生和性成熟而稳定增加,热应急实验显示该基因的表达与温度相关.综上所述,该文克隆了人的1个新基因,该基因与精子的发生和性成熟相关.
